[QUOTE="Paul215, post: 81966, member: 13996"] Hey Guys, here I want to present my new tablet holder to you. After a lot research I haven't found the right holder that fits all my needs. The biggest problem was my iPad case. I use a Griffin Survivor case with fat rubber edges. With that my iPad becomes around 3 times thicker than orginal an all holders are to small. Another problem with a lot of holders is that the antennas pointing a little bit downwards because the tablet is in the way. Only possibility for me was a DIY solution. So I started drawing and that was the result: [ATTACH]9009[/ATTACH] The black (orange) parts are 3D-printed (ABS). The X-shaped fixing fits perfect for my case. The silver parts are cheap aluminum tubes. The ones from the remote-plate to the lower holder are 10mm tubes. On the inside are 8mm tubes which are spring loaded and connected with the upper holder. So I have no visible springs or rubber bands and the iPad fits tight.
